Exploring the Ancient Pagoda and Buddhist Philosophy

As part of the vegan cooking class, participants have the opportunity to visit an ancient pagoda and learn about the Buddhist philosophy that’s deeply intertwined with Vietnamese veganism.

At the pagoda, the knowledgeable guide provides insights into the significance of Buddhist principles like non-violence and respect for all living beings. Guests gain a deeper understanding of how these spiritual beliefs have influenced the rise of veganism in Vietnam.

Cooking Techniques: Crafting Summer Rolls and Tofu Pho

Rolling and wrapping rice paper is the first essential technique learned in crafting authentic Vietnamese summer rolls. Participants explore the art of moistening and handling the delicate rice wrappers, then arrange a vibrant array of fillings – crunchy veggies, fragrant herbs, and marinated tofu.

Shaping the rolls with care, they learn to fold and tuck the edges to create compact, photogenic bites. Next, they tackle the intricacies of making flavorful vegan pho.

Simmering a fragrant broth, they add rice noodles, silky tofu, and an array of fresh garnishes. Mastering these fundamental techniques, participants savor the fruits of their labor.
